Store luggage at AUH?

Store luggage at AUH?

  1. Neel New Member

    I’m flying JFK-AUH-BOM in F with a 9+ hour layover at AUH and was planning on leaving the airport to see some sights. Is it possible to leave luggage somewhere in the airport so I don’t have to carry it with me? Do they offer this in either the EY departures or arrivals lounges?

    Also, is it possible to use the chauffeur service “unofficially” while in transit like described in [URL]http://onemileatatime.boardingarea.com/2015/01/29/how-to-still-get-emirates-chauffeur-on-alaska-award-tickets/[/URL] for Emirates?

  2. PhatMiles Member

    AUH has luggage storage.
    See this:
    [URL]http://www.abudhabiairport.ae/english/media/airport-service-centre_tcm13-4159.pdf[/URL]

  3. Anonymous Guest

    Hi [USER=304]@Neel[/USER]! In terms of the chauffeur, that likely won’t work. You can ask, of course, but Etihad seems to have a stricter system.
